29:Digging into the Dark: The Science of Noir Films

Join us in the basement studio with special guest Jim Siergey as we explore the fascinating world of noir films, their historical context, and the evolution of forensics in cinema.

In this episode, Joe, Georgia, and Nick welcome special guest Jim Siergey, a cartoonist and animator known for being one of the creators of the underground comix strip 'Cultural Jetlag' in the 1990s. The group dives into an engaging discussion on the science and style of noir films. They cover key aspects such as the definitive elements of the genre, famous examples, and the evolution of forensics in relation to noir storytelling. Throughout the episode, the hosts share their thoughts on whether certain modern films qualify as noir and the impact of the Hays Code on classic films. They also announce their upcoming art show, 'Touch of Noir,' at the Promise You Art House in Highland, Indiana. The conversation wraps up with a light-hearted chat about dry January and their current favorite non-alcoholic beverages.
